New England winters hit Lowell hard. Temperatures drop below 20 degrees for weeks at a time, and that cold makes garage door springs brittle. Springs typically last 7 to 9 years in moderate climates, but in Lowell they often fail earlier because of freeze-thaw cycles. Metal tracks contract, rollers stiffen, and opener motors strain harder in January than June.
The most common call we get from Lowell is the classic "my door won't open and I'm late for work" scenario. Usually it's a snapped torsion spring. Sometimes it's a stripped opener gear or a cable that jumped the drum overnight. Either way, you need someone who stocks the right parts and knows how to get there fast.

Our spring replacement service covers both torsion and extension systems. We carry high-cycle springs rated for 25,000 to 30,000 operations because cheap 10,000-cycle springs are a waste of money in this climate. Most Lowell spring jobs take 60 to 90 minutes from arrival to testing.
Garage door opener installation is straightforward when you work with quality brands. We install LiftMaster, Chamberlain, and Genie models with battery backup (essential during Lowell's ice storm power outages). Belt drives run quieter if your bedroom sits above the garage. Chain drives cost less and handle heavier wooden doors common in older Lowell homes. We'll walk you through the options without the sales pitch.
Cable and roller repairs often get overlooked until something jams. Frayed cables are dangerous because they can snap under tension. Worn rollers create that grinding noise you hear every morning. We replace both during routine service calls, and it usually adds just 20 minutes to a spring job.
Full door replacement makes sense when repair costs approach half the price of a new door. We install insulated steel doors (R-value 12 to 18) that cut heat loss and dampen street noise. What's the difference between your spring options?
Standard springs are rated for 10,000 cycles (about 7 years for typical use). High-cycle springs last 25,000 to 30,000 cycles, which translates to 15 to 20 years. The upgrade costs about $40 more but prevents another service call a decade sooner. We recommend high-cycle for Lowell's harsh weather because freeze-thaw stress shortens spring life.
